Question 1: Metal gas piping in a building must be bonded per NEC 250.104(B) to which of the following?
- The nearest grounding rod
- The equipment grounding conductor of the circuit likely to energize the piping (Correct answer)
- The cold water pipe at the water heater
- The main service panel neutral bar only
Correct answer: The equipment grounding conductor of the circuit likely to energize the piping
Per NEC 250.104(B), interior metal gas piping must be bonded to the equipment grounding conductor of the circuit that is most likely to energize the piping.
Question 2: What is the maximum size copper equipment grounding conductor that may be bare (uninsulated) when installed in a raceway?
- Any size may be bare in a raceway (Correct answer)
- 6 AWG and smaller must be insulated
- No restriction — bare is always allowed
- Only 4 AWG and larger may be bare
Correct answer: Any size may be bare in a raceway
Per NEC 250.119, equipment grounding conductors of any size may be bare, covered, or insulated when installed in a raceway.
Question 3: A patient care area in a hospital requires what type of grounding system per NEC 517?
- Standard equipment grounding with GFCI outlets
- An isolated (ungrounded) power system with a line isolation monitor (Correct answer)
- Double-insulated equipment only — no grounding required
- A redundant grounding electrode system
Correct answer: An isolated (ungrounded) power system with a line isolation monitor
NEC Article 517 requires critical care areas to use an isolated (ungrounded) power system with a line isolation monitor to allow the circuit to continue operating during a first fault.
Question 4: Which of the following correctly describes the difference between grounding and bonding?
- Grounding connects equipment to earth; bonding connects conductive parts to each other (Correct answer)
- Bonding connects equipment to earth; grounding connects conductive parts to each other
- They are interchangeable terms with no distinction
- Grounding is for AC systems; bonding is for DC systems only
Correct answer: Grounding connects equipment to earth; bonding connects conductive parts to each other
Grounding connects the electrical system to earth (the grounding electrode system), while bonding connects conductive parts together to ensure electrical continuity.
Question 5: When a panelboard is used as service equipment, the equipment grounding terminal bar must be bonded to the enclosure using a:
- Equipment bonding jumper
- Grounding electrode conductor
- Main bonding jumper (Correct answer)
- System bonding jumper
Correct answer: Main bonding jumper
At service equipment, the main bonding jumper connects the neutral (grounded conductor) terminal bar to the equipment enclosure and the EGC terminal bar.
Question 6: What NEC rule applies to the grounding electrode conductor at the point it connects to a water pipe electrode?
- The connection must be accessible and made with a listed clamp (Correct answer)
- The connection may be made with any listed wire connector
- Soldering is the preferred connection method
- The conductor must be spliced at least once before the connection
Correct answer: The connection must be accessible and made with a listed clamp
Per NEC 250.70, connections to grounding electrodes must be made with listed fittings, and connections to pipe electrodes must be accessible and made with listed clamps.
Question 7: An equipment grounding conductor run with circuit conductors in a conduit system primarily protects against:
- Voltage drop under heavy load
- Electric shock from a ground fault on equipment (Correct answer)
- Inductive reactance in the conductors
- Overheating of the grounded conductor
Correct answer: Electric shock from a ground fault on equipment
The EGC provides a low-impedance path for fault current to return to the source, causing the overcurrent device to open and protect against electric shock from faulted equipment.
